PHOENIX — The Arizona Cardinals are coming off one of their worst seasons in franchise history, but Glendale is still a good place to be a football fan.

Wallet Hub ranked Glendale as the 12th-best city to be a football fan in 2019 out of more than 240 American cities.

The Phoenix suburb finished ahead of cities like Denver, Atlanta and Los Angeles, whose team, the Rams, is playing in the Super Bowl on Sunday.

The cities were ranked across 21 metrics, including number of NFL and college football teams, average NFL ticket price and fan friendliness.

Glendale performed well in the category of most accessible NFL stadium, ranking No. 3.

Unfortunately, it was dinged pretty harshly because of the Cardinals’ recent failures.

Glendale was tied at No. 26 with Jacksonville for worst-performing NFL team.

Pittsburgh finished as the best city to be a football fan while Boston, Green Bay, Dallas and New York City rounded out the top five.

Other Arizona cities who made the list were Flagstaff (No. 135), Tempe (No. 186) and Tucson (No. 193).
